Cladding Installation Service in Boston, MA
Cladding installation services involve attaching exterior materials to a property’s walls to enhance its appearance, improve insulation, and protect against weather elements. These projects can include installing siding, stone veneer, fiber cement panels, or other cladding materials on residential buildings, such as homes and multi-family properties. Homeowners often seek this service when updating the look of their property, repairing damaged siding, or increasing energy efficiency. Before requesting cladding installation, property owners typically want to understand the types of materials available, the durability of different options, and how the installation process may impact their property.
It is important for property owners to consider the scope of their project, including the size of the area to be covered and any necessary preparations or repairs beforehand. Clarifying the desired aesthetic and understanding the maintenance requirements of different cladding materials can help ensure satisfaction with the finished result. Additionally, asking about the installation process, weather considerations, and any potential disruptions can help homeowners plan accordingly for a smooth and successful project.

Cladding Installation Service Questions
What types of buildings can benefit from cladding installation? Cladding can enhance both residential and commercial properties, providing improved insulation and exterior protection.
What materials are commonly used for cladding? Popular options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al, each offering different aesthetic and durability benefits.
Is cladding installation suitable for retrofitting existing structures? Yes, cladding can be added to existing buildings to update appearance and improve performance.
What should property owners consider before choosing cladding? Factors include the building’s style, climate conditions, and maintenance requirements to select the best cladding type.
